As an explicit formal and standard specification of a shared conceptual model, ontology has been extensively used in knowledge engineering, semantic web and information retrieve fields. Ontology modeling is the foundation for the study of ontology. It involves the processing of domain knowledge, which derives from natural language and with much uncertainty. Therefore, to bulding a reasonable and objective cloud ontology, it is very necessary to study on the theory and method of the combination of uncertainty knowledge and ontology.Aiming at the problem of uncertainty knowledge representation and inference in agricultural cloud ontology, this paper focuses on the three key problems in the agricultural cloud ontology generation:formalization, logic checking, graphic. We propose a theory and method with regard to the generation of agricultural cloud ontology, and develop a prototype system of agricultural cloud ontology generation.The main content and research achievements are as follows:(1) The formalization of agricultural cloud ontology is proposed. Through the extended description logic C-SHOIN(D) based on cloud model and cloud ontology language Cloud-OWL based on C-SHOIN(D), the formal representation of cloud ontology knowledge is proposed, which takes tea garden meteorological cloud ontology as its test object.(2) The methods and algorithm for the logic checking and graphical of agricultural cloud ontology is put forward. Through the optimized Tableau algorithm and the extended C-SHOIN(D) reasoning rule, the logic checking of agricultural cloud ontology is accomplished and then discuss the function and each process step of agricultural cloud ontology logic checking modules. Besides, the graphical methods and algorithm of agricultural cloud ontology is also given.(3) A prototype system of agricultural cloud ontology generation is developed. This prototype system is developed in Eclipse platform with Java language, which can realiaze the logic checking and graphical of agricultural cloud ontology. Besides, the validity and feasibIUity of the methods of agricultural cloud ontology generation is proved through experiments.The research result of this paper has certain theoretical value and practical significance in many aspects, for example, the further study of the theory and method of agricultural cloud ontology generation, the building of a more accurate and objective agricultural cloud ontology, the establishment of agricultural knowledge service based on cloud ontology, and the realization of efficient reuse and effective management of agricultural knowledge.
